We will be visiting Universal IOA in Noverber 11-14 and then 14-19 at WDW.
We are a family of 4, 2 kids ages 13 and 10.
We are renting a car and this is our first time to visit universal.
I am thinking we will stay on property the RPR.
I have been doing a little research on the subject and am looking for suggestions as to weather it what would be the most cost effective.
Buying 1 annual pass and using discounts to get other passes for family and discounts for room, as well as food and others merchandise.
Is this the best route to take, or are there other discounts or promotions to look into.
We also have AAA.

TIA for all help

Patti
 
I would only Purchase the Preffered Annual Pass if you plan on using it more the 4 times. Other wise there are other alternatives such as AAA discount or book as a package from Universal Studios Vacations and The hotel sometimes offers free tickets with your length of stay,
